Pre-Purchase Assessment



Prior to purchasing a vintage car, it's important to carry out a comprehensive pre-purchase assessment to ensure you're making an educated decision. This inspection involves thoroughly checking out the automobile's exterior, inside, and mechanical components.

Beginning by checking for any kind of indicators of corrosion or damage on the body, including the undercarriage and wheel wells. Look for any kind of mismatched paint or body panels, as this could suggest previous repair services.

Inside the auto, inspect the furniture, dashboard, and electric elements to make sure whatever remains in good condition. Do not fail to remember to test all the lights, buttons, and gauges too.

Finally, have a mechanic examine the engine, transmission, brakes, and suspension to ensure they remain in correct functioning order.

Regular Liquid Checks



To make sure optimal performance and long life of your classic car, frequently inspecting its fluids is essential. Keeping an eye on the different liquids in your vehicle is essential to its overall health and capability.

Beginning by inspecting the engine oil consistently, as it lubricates the relocating parts and protects against rubbing. Make sure the transmission liquid goes to the proper degree, as it allows for smooth changing and stops damage to the gearbox.

Additionally, keep an eye on the coolant degree to avoid getting too hot and make certain proper engine temperature level. Correct Storage and Defense



Routinely inspecting and maintaining the liquids in your vintage car is critical, and now let's concentrate on the importance of proper storage and protection.



When it involves saving your classic automobile, locating the right area is key. You want to maintain it in a tidy, completely dry, and well-ventilated room to prevent corrosion and rust. Ensure to cover it with a breathable cars and truck cover to secure it from dirt, dust, and scratches.
